[MEGOLDVA THX:ATom] Merevlemez vezérlő SSD-hez

Sziasztok!

Meglévő szerverben szeretnék másik merevlemez vezérlőt rakni, amivel ki tudom használni az SSD-k sebességét.
Ne kelljen semmilyen HWRAID funkciót beállítani, hogy közvetlenül lássa a rendszer az SSD-ket.
Debian Jessie az alaprendszer.

Az alábbi jelöltek vannak:
DELL PERC H200 8PORT 6GBPS SAS PCI-E RAID CONTROLLER DELL CN-047MCV 065F44
HP SMART ARRAY P410 RAID CONTROLLER 6GBPS SAS 256MB CACHE PCI-E HIGH PROFILE HP 462919-001
DELL PERC H310 NV CACHE 8PORT 6GBPS SAS PCI-E RAID CONTROLLER HV52W 3P0R3 0HV52W
LSI LOGIC SAS9212-4I4E SAS HBA 6GBPS RAID 0,1,1E,10, 4X SATA 1X EXTERNAL MINISAS 8088 PCI-E HIGH PROFILE IBM 68Y7354

Van valakinek konkrét tapasztalata ezekkel a vezérlőkkel?

Előre is köszönöm.

2017.02.12.
Megoldva:
DELL PERC H200 IT módban (9211-es LSI/Avago firmware-rel)
Berakod, megy ...
Tesztek ok, élesben dolgozik a szerverben.

DELL PERC H310 NV
Egyszer kell megmondani a vezérlőnek, hogy csak adja át a lemezeket.
Teszteken csinált furcsaságokat, ezért nem került éles rendszerbe.

LSI SAS 9211-8I
Lemezeket látta, de nem bootolt.
Mint kiderült, nem volt rajta UEFI boot rom.

Hozzászólások

Miért nem valami PCI-Expresses SSD-vel próbálkozol? Vagy kell a hot-swap? Szerintem nem kötelező egyikkel sem RAID tömböt állítgatni, valamint a legolcsóbb szoftveres vagy host-only kártyát keresd, aminek a vezérlőjét támogatja a kernel és még vannak rajta belső csatik az előlapi rackekhez.
Kiindulásnak: eleve felesleges bármelyik számodra, amelyiken van dedikált RAM, amin még akksi is van az meg pláne :D

Én inkább olyan adaptert keresnék a helyedbe, amire lehet tenni 2-3 M2 tokozású SSD-t.
Hacsak nem akarsz eleve integrált PCI-E SSD-t venni.

Több okból:
1) a régebbi raid vezérlők eléggé vacakul kezelik az SSD-t. Pl a P410i biztosan. Az az intel SSD ami a 410-ben ~180-220mbyte/s-el dolgozott a p420-ban máris 500mbyte/s volt.

2) az M2 PCI-E interfésszel bíró SSD ~3-4x gyorsabb (értsd ~2000mbyte/s) mint a SATA-III

3) a PCI-E SSD-ről nem feltétlen tudsz boot-olni

A DELL/HP-t szerintem hanyagold, hacsak nem DELL/HP szerverbe szánod! A DELL H-s vezérlők is LSI-k, de a DELL-es FW nem adja át neked direktben a drive-okat, csak RAID tömbként (1 disk-es R0 tömböket kell csinálnod)
A listából max. az LSI, de ahogy többen is írták, ha nem akarsz RAID-et, akkor első sorban ne RAID kártyát nézegess!

----------------------------------^v--------------------------------------
"Probléma esetén nyomják meg a piros gombot és nyugodjanak békében!"

Na, ezzel határozottan vigyázni kell, mert egy pár évvel ezelőtti firmware frissítésnél határozottan úgy rémlik, hogy kitiltották a nem-HP gépeket. Kipróbáltuk, és valóban: gyakorlatilag semmilyen nem-HP szerverben nem bírtuk elindítani a P410 kártyákat. (vagy csak áll a BIOS-nál, és nem megy tovább, vagy spontán rebootol)

Az sem nagyon opció, hogy régebbi firmware-t használsz, mert pl. a legutolsó (6.64-es) verzióban jött meg a javítás arra a hibára, hogy SATA diszkek esetén néha controller panic-ot kapsz SMART lekérdezésnél, meg egyéb nagyszerű bugok is voltak a korábbi firmware verziókban.

Szerencsére megúsztam a controller panicot eddig :D SMART nincs, mert egyszeri parasztszerver gépébe nem olyan létszükséglet :D Nincs fontos adat, vagyis napi backup van, szóval reprodukálható. Így ha lenne akkor nem is érint igazán, de viszont jó tudni, hogy ha egyszer lesz rebootolási lehetőség akkor ne frissítsek, köszi :)

Akkor örülök, hogy mégsem én vagyok a hülye :) Bár, nekem csak régebbi HP vezérlővel volt tapasztalatom, aminek a BIOS-a úgy hozzá volt drótozva a HP gép BIOS-ához, hogy más gépben nem lehetett előcsalogatni. Ha egy HP-ben felkonfiguráltam a tömböt, utána ment szépen az IBM szerverbe átrakva is, csak ne kelljen hozzányúlni!

----------------------------------^v--------------------------------------
"Probléma esetén nyomják meg a piros gombot és nyugodjanak békében!"

Totál amatőr kérdés: a P410-nek van ugye 2 csatlakozója, amire X darab (spec. én nem tudom pontosan mennyi az X) eszközt lehet kötni. Ehhez milyen kábel kell ha nem keret/cage/tökömtudja-HP-hogy-nevezi elektronikán keresztül dugnám rá a HDD-ket, hanem "közvetlenül" mindenféle "keret" nélküli SATA vinyót - vinyókat akarok rákötni? Ilyen esetben valami "hydra" kábel kellene, azaz egyik vége rádug a controller csatlakozójára, másik oldalon meg elágazik pl. 4 párhuzamos ágra, és így 4 db SATA vinyót rá lehet kötni direktben? Csak azért kérdezem, mert egy nem-HP / nem-brand gépben nem lesz olyan keret mint ami a HP-nek van, szóval hogy megy ilyenkor az összeköttetés?
--

"A DELL H-s vezérlők is LSI-k, de a DELL-es FW nem adja át neked direktben a drive-okat, csak RAID tömbként (1 disk-es R0 tömböket kell csinálnod)"
Ez például H730nál nem igaz, át lehet kapcsolni RAID módból HBA módba (iDRAC-en keresztül biztos, BIOS-ban sosem próbáltam).

DELL PERC H310-en készítettem már Linux soft RAID-et, lehet rajta Non-RAID módot állítani, minden rádugott vinyón meg kell csinálni egyszer az állítást és kész.
LSI SAS9211-8I-n ha nem állítasz rajta semmit, akkor is azonnal látja a Linux az összes vinyót.

Közben találtam még neked raktáron a DELL PERC H310 mellé, LSI LOGIC SAS9211-8I-t is.
Mindkettőt elviszem neked. Próbáld ki, aztán eldöntöd melyik a szimpatikus neked.

Ajánlom figyelmedbe az Adaptec vezérlőket. Natívan van hozzá debianos kliensprogram. Mi az Adaptec 7805 vezérlőket használjuk.

Neked egy sima HBA kell ilyen célra, nem RAID kártya. LSI HBA-k jók pl.

A meglévő szerverről (típus, cpu, ram, RAID kártya/BBU, OS stb) és a meglévő SSD-kről megtudhatunk valamit?

Dell H310 IT módba flash-elve, tökéletes.

Mivel vezérlőt keresel, azért ajánlom, nézz el az NVMe irányba. ;-)
Bár konkrét tapasztalat nincs, de a tesztek bíztatóak, Linux támogatás van - és mivel itt a vezérlő és az SSD általában összeépített, ezért esélyesen a két HW komponens között nem lesz HW inkompatibilitás. :-)